Abstract

The behavior is carried out without coercion or expecting any reward. The extraordinary quality of service and the dedication to work with high standards are clear signs that OCB's behavior is present in every village apparatus in the organization. This behavior describes the added value of employees, a form of prosocial behavior, namely positive, constructive, and meaningful social behavior that helps the village organization progress. The approach method used to achieve the output, the community involvement PKM program in the Organizational Citizenship Behavior (OCB) mechanism taught, will be adapted through socialization. These goals can be achieved through 2 (two) approaches. The PkM team accompanied the PkM participants to make a presentation related to the importance of OCB being understood to reach an understanding regarding the authority and implementation of programs carried out by Village Heads, Urban Villages, and related agencies, including the Banjar City Youth, Sports, and Tourism Office. This understanding is related to OCB because it can increase the effectiveness and welfare of the organization. This voluntary behavior creates a positive work environment, reduces conflict, and increases team collaboration. The discussion of OCB usually involves the application of this concept in the context of human resource management (HRM) and organizational strategy. Understanding and managing OCB can help organizations create a productive and positive work environment.
